
For the first time, All Elite Wrestling has publicly and directly referenced the suspension of a star on-air.
On tonight’s edition (December 2) of AEW Rampage featured AEW commentary publicly addressing a recent suspension on-air for the first time.
During a match between Athena and Dani Mo, commentary referenced her previous incident of attacked referee Aubrey Edwards after a match.
According to commentary, Athena was suspended for five days and also had her pay suspended during that time as well.
Athena and her new dastardly persona will go on to the upcoming Ring of Honor pay-per-view, Final Battle to face ROH Women’s Champion Mercedes Martinez for the title.
Still no public official comment on the suspensions of Andrade el Idolo or CM Punk.
Elsewhere on tonight’s AEW Rampage, there was a Lumberjack Match for the All-Atlantic Championship between QT Marshall and Orange Cassidy with both the Best Friends and the Factory at ringside.
